Heard AH-MM400 for half an hour in a store today, from my DX90, materials are super nice and I was surprised by the superb comfort, but I found them boomy all over the place. In bassheavy tunes it was much too much for me. I found the mids/treble withdrawn too, so overall quite muddled (all IMO of course). I love bass, but coming from SE846 this was a BIG step in the very wrong direction for me. IMO SE846 goes lower and more importantly are not boomy, although they are double the price I did'nt expect the MM400 to be that much behind.
